Video: Police Officer In Connecticut Joins Teens Dancing In Parking Lot

NEW BRITAIN, Conn. (CBSNewYork) -- A police officer in New Britain, Conn. is dancing his way closer to the community.

Patrolman Matt Sulek, 26, was seen on video dancing with a group of teenagers in a Walgreens parking lot.

Sulek said the teens turned off the music when he drove by, but he told them to crank it up.

He said he was trying to bridge the gap with the community and show that police officers can be a part of young people's lives.

His moves got high marks with the group.
